Merge branch 'ripplebiz:main' into faketec-support

This commit is contained in:
oltaco 2025-03-13 16:22:02 +11:00 committed by GitHub
commit c8104563a0
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
9 changed files with 264 additions and 111 deletions

View file

@ -22,11 +22,11 @@
/* ------------------------------ Config -------------------------------- */
#ifndef FIRMWARE_BUILD_DATE
#define FIRMWARE_BUILD_DATE "9 Mar 2025"
#define FIRMWARE_BUILD_DATE "13 Mar 2025"
#endif
#ifndef FIRMWARE_VERSION
#define FIRMWARE_VERSION "v1.2.2"
#define FIRMWARE_VERSION "v1.3.0"
#endif
#ifndef LORA_FREQ
@ -308,7 +308,9 @@ protected:
}
bool allowPacketForward(const mesh::Packet* packet) override {
return !_prefs.disable_fwd;
if (_prefs.disable_fwd) return false;
if (packet->isRouteFlood() && packet->path_len >= _prefs.flood_max) return false;
return true;
}
void onAnonDataRecv(mesh::Packet* packet, uint8_t type, const mesh::Identity& sender, uint8_t* data, size_t len) override {
@ -572,6 +574,7 @@ public:
_prefs.tx_power_dbm = LORA_TX_POWER;
_prefs.disable_fwd = 1;
_prefs.advert_interval = 1; // default to 2 minutes for NEW installs
_prefs.flood_max = 64;
#ifdef ROOM_PASSWORD
StrHelper::strncpy(_prefs.guest_password, ROOM_PASSWORD, sizeof(_prefs.guest_password));
#endif